Lafarge, Holcim and Carpatcement Holding are keeping cement prices in Romania at the same level, whereas brick, ACC and reinforcing steel manufacturers have operated price cuts of 10-15% due to the consumption decline.

Cement manufacturers say, however, that they may adjust prices in spring, if demand continues to fall.

At the end of last year the price of cement went down as much as 50%, from a record high of EUR140/t in the summer, but only distributor prices, as they had to sell the large stocks accumulated following the reduction in consumption.
